I just replaced the timing chain, tensioner, timing cover gasket and head gasket on a 1997 Cavalier LS 2.2L that I got for $250. Car runs fine runs at normal operating temperature and everything. The problem is the oil light keeps coming on. I originally thought the oil was low because during lunch yesterday I didnt get the cap all the way down and on so the reading was off. I added a quart thinking that I had went through about 3 qts in 2-3 days. Well, I figured out I was wrong and now have a TAD bit over full, no big deal. Here is what I am noticing:

The reason I thought I was low is the oil light keeps coming on... Mostly on deceleration and from what I can tell seems to come on at LOWER than 1200 rpms (if you are higher than that it goes off)... Is the light oil level??? Or oil pressure??? Or can it come on for both??? The car did throw a code also yesterday that I need to get read now, but last night I found out autozone only reads codes until 5pm (those lazy punks). Is there anyway to "flash" the code (short the circuit and then the light flashes long and short to give you a number for the code you have)???

Is it maybe the sensor going bad??? Oil pump??? Any common problems related to/similar to this???

If I recall correctly (don't pay much attention to the start-up light check anymore LOL), The red oil can is pressure, and the orange 'OIL' is for oil level. The level sensor is in the side of the oil pan.

on my old 95 2.2, the oil level sensor, which is right in the front of the pan, exploded. My oil light kept coming on, so i drained the oil and checked the sensor, or what was left, and ended up having to take the oil pan off to clean out all the plastic.
